What Is an Electronic Throttle Body?
An electronic throttle body is a component that controls the airflow into an engine based on how much pressure you apply to the accelerator pedal. Unlike older mechanical systems that use cables and linkages, electronic throttle bodies rely on electronic sensors and actuators for precise airflow management.
This transition to electronic control means better fuel efficiency. For instance, cars equipped with electronic throttle bodies can improve fuel economy by up to 10% compared to traditional systems. By integrating with the engine control unit (ECU), the electronic throttle body constantly adjusts air intake according to real-time driving conditions.
What Happens When an Electric Throttle Body Goes Bad?
When an electronic throttle body malfunctions, it can cause significant performance issues. Drivers might notice symptoms such as rough idling, unexpected stalling, or sluggish acceleration. Power loss and increased fuel consumption are common indicators as well. In critical situations, vehicles may enter "limp mode," drastically reducing speed and limiting engine power to prevent damage.
The internal components, like the motor or position sensor, may degrade over time. For example, a study found that nearly 15% of throttle body failures stem from sensor malfunctions. Identifying these signs early can prevent more serious engine problems.
What Does an Electronic Throttle Body Do?
The main role of the electronic throttle body is to regulate the amount of air entering the engine, which impacts power and efficiency. When you press the accelerator pedal, the throttle body receives a signal from the pedal position sensor to adjust the airflow accordingly.
This results in smoother acceleration and better throttle response, contributing to improved fuel economy—sometimes by as much as 20% in urban driving conditions. The ECU also gathers data from various sensors to fine-tune throttle position, ensuring optimal engine performance no matter the driving situation.
How Do You Know When Your Throttle Body Is Bad?
Recognizing the signs of a failing throttle body helps prevent breakdowns. Here are some common symptoms to watch for:
Illuminated Check Engine Light: This light may indicate throttle body problems.
Rough Idle: Fluctuating engine speed while idling can signal issues.
Stalling: The engine could stall unexpectedly, especially during acceleration.
Poor Fuel Efficiency: A noticeable increase in your fuel bills may be due to throttle body issues.
Unresponsive Accelerator: If the car doesn’t speed up as expected when you press the pedal, the throttle body could be at fault.
Acting quickly on these signs can save you from bigger repairs down the line.
What Is the Difference Between a Throttle Body and a Carburetor?
Though both throttle bodies and carburetors control air and fuel flow to the engine, they work very differently.
Carburetors use mechanical principles where airflow creates a vacuum that pulls fuel into the airflow. This system requires regular tuning for optimal performance and can be difficult to maintain.
In contrast, an electronic throttle body employs electronic sensors and actuators for precise airflow control. This method is generally more efficient and responsive compared to carburetors. As a result, most modern engines now use electronic throttle bodies rather than carburetors.
What Is an Electronic Throttle Body Used For?
Electronic throttle bodies are found in both gasoline and diesel engines in various vehicles, providing multiple benefits such as:
Improved Engine Performance: Effective airflow regulation enhances engine efficiency.
Emissions Control: The precise control helps meet more stringent emissions regulations.
Adaptability: The system can adjust to different driving conditions, maximizing performance whether on the highway or at a stoplight.
Enhanced Safety Features: Integration with advanced driver-assist technologies enables features like adaptive cruise control.
These benefits solidify the presence of electronic throttle bodies in modern automotive engineering.

What Is an Electronic Throttle Body on a Car?
The electronic throttle body is typically located between the air intake and the intake manifold. It plays a crucial role in ensuring efficient engine performance while complying with emissions standards.
Equipped with sensors that monitor the throttle plate position and incoming airflow, it communicates with the ECU to optimize performance dynamically. Knowing where it’s located and how it functions can help you identify performance issues sooner.
How to Fix Electronic Throttle Control
If you're experiencing problems with electronic throttle control, consider these steps for resolution:
Diagnostic Check: Use a diagnostic scanner to identify specific throttle body trouble codes.
Inspect Connections: Ensure that all electrical connectors to the throttle body are secure and undamaged.
Cleaning: A dirty throttle body can malfunction; cleaning it with a throttle body cleaner according to the manufacturer's guidelines can often restore its function.
Sensor Replacement: If a specific sensor shows faults, replacing it may resolve the problem.
Professional Help: For persistent issues, seeking professional assistance is wise for a thorough investigation and repair.
Addressing electronic throttle control issues promptly can keep your vehicle running efficiently.

Electronic Throttle Control Module
The electronic throttle control module acts as the brain of the throttle body system. It interprets input from the accelerator pedal sensor and other sensors to instruct the throttle body on adjusting airflow.
Should the module fail, tasks like sudden acceleration or engine stalling can occur. Replacing a faulty module typically resolves these performance issues.
Electronic Throttle Body Replacement
If your electronic throttle body is beyond repair, a replacement is the best option. The process generally involves:
Removing the Old Throttle Body: Disconnect electrical connectors and remove securing bolts.
Installing the New Throttle Body: Secure the new unit and reconnect all connections.
Recalibrating the System: Resetting the ECU to recognize the new throttle body is often necessary for optimal function.
Consult your vehicle’s service manual or seek a professional mechanic for specific replacement guidelines.
Electronic Throttle Body Sensor

The electronic throttle body sensor is essential for accurate airflow management. The throttle position sensor (TPS) tracks the throttle plate's angle and sends this data to the ECU for precise adjustments.
If the sensor misaligns or fails, it leads to performance issues like unstable acceleration. Regular inspections and timely sensor replacements can sustain your engine’s performance.
